The Gallery's Perspective
You can feel the music in the way these figures lean and step together — a communal energy that’s both playful and purposeful. Charles Bibbs’ lithograph arranges a crowd of caps, headwraps, boots and loose trousers into a near‑continuous wave of bodies, each rendered with warm sepia and green washes and fine cross‑hatched line. Faces and postures are individualized yet rhythmically linked: some look forward with intent, others glance back or curve into the next person, creating a sense of movement and conversation across the composition. The limited palette and delicate layering give the scene a slightly worn, intimate quality, like a memory held in sepia tones. It reads as a celebration of shared life — style, motion and companionship — that brings both character and a gentle buoyancy to a room where it hangs.

"Discover the captivating world of Charles Bibbs, a renowned African American contemporary artist known for his vibrant, symbolic art that blends abstract figurative forms with rich cultural storytelling. His work draws deeply from African heritage, infusing each piece with bold color palettes and dynamic, expressive figures. Bibbs’ modern African American art explores themes of identity, tradition, and empowerment, creating visually stunning mixed media compositions that resonate with a diverse audience. Whether you’re looking for colorful figurative art or symbolic abstract art, Charles Bibbs offers an artistic experience that celebrates cultural expression and heritage."
